Figura "Caballos" de jade tallado, dinastía Qing
Carved jade figure of light tonality with reddish-golden stains and patina produced by aging. It represents two beautiful horses lying on their legs, both arranged in reverse, tilting their heads to look at each other serenely. Their forelegs are bent and their tails are raised, brushing against each other's faces as a symbol of constant union.
Horses played an important role of growth and protection in China. They were so fundamental that their figure is related to status, talents, good luck and power. In addition, the fact that the material used is jade shows that it is made with meaning.
Measurements: 4,4 x 5,2 x 5,2 cm
Weight: 94,5 g
